July 19, 2012 – The seventh edition of the Standard Catalog of World Coins 2001-Date is now available from Krause Publications.

George S. Cuhaj and Thomas Michael, 2013 Standard Catalog of World Coins 2001-Date, 7th edition. Krause Publications, Iola (Wis.) 2012. 960 p., 8,000 b/w illustrations. 8.25 x 10.88 cm, Paperback. ISBN 9781440229657. $44.99.

Insightful data for each featured coin, collected and reviewed by a panel of more than 200 respected coin experts worldwide, fill the pages of this latest edition. More than 200 additional pages of new entries ensure that collectors will have the largest source of information available on coins from all across the world.

This latest edition will present collectors with the most up-to-date information on coin prices, allowing for well-informed decisions to enhance any modern-issue collection.

New mint issues from across the world, including the ever-growing array of bullion coins, are present. Complete with key coin specifications, the Standard Catalog also provides background about each country’s monetary history and an incredible 12,500 actual-size coin illustrations. Both new entries and past updates are presented in the familiar, authoritative Standard Catalog style. The reference work includes coverage of collector coins, sets, trial strikes, pieforts and patterns.

The authors
Editor George S. Cuhaj is an 18-year veteran of Krause Publications’ Numismatic Catalog Division, where he is also the editor of the Standard Catalog of World Coins series. Cuhaj hails from New York City, where he was previously on staff with the American Numismatic Society, Stack’s Rare Coins and R.M. Smythe & Co. He is a frequent instructor at the American Numismatic Association’s Summer Seminars.

Market Analyst Tom Michael serves as market analyst for Krause Publications coin catalogs, and has done so for early 100 world and U.S. coin catalogs. He has more than 20 years of experience researching and reporting on world coin prices and market trends.
